One of the most common mistakes Saginaw homeowners make is assuming the opener is broken when the real problem is a broken spring. A door with a failed spring is too heavy for the opener to lift — the motor strains, the drive belt or chain slips, and the opener appears to have failed. The most common opener complaint in Saginaw. Could be dead batteries, a remote that needs reprogramming, or a failed receiver board. We diagnose and fix it in minutes.
The logic board is the brain of your opener. When it fails in Saginaw, the opener may not respond at all, behave erratically, or lose all programming. We carry boards for the most common models.
The opener runs but the door doesn't move — this usually means a broken drive belt or stripped chain. Our Saginaw trucks carry drive belts and chains for all major opener brands.
Sensors at the bottom of the door tracks must be aligned for the door to close. Misaligned sensors cause the door to reverse immediately after closing. Quick fix in Saginaw — usually 15 minutes.
The capacitor provides the starting torque for the motor. When it fails in Saginaw, the motor hums but won't start. We carry capacitors for all major opener brands on every truck.
Incorrect limit switch settings cause the door to not open or close fully in Saginaw. The door may reverse before reaching the floor or stop before fully opening. Easy adjustment by our technicians.
Smart openers in Saginaw can lose WiFi connectivity after router changes or firmware updates. We reconfigure and reconnect smart openers to your home network and smartphone app.

This usually means the opener has become disconnected from the door (the red emergency release cord was pulled), the trolley carriage is stripped, or the door has a broken spring preventing movement. Our Saginaw technicians can diagnose this in minutes.

This is almost always a safety sensor issue in Saginaw. The two sensors at the bottom of the door tracks must be aligned and unobstructed. Check that both sensors show a solid light (not blinking). If the problem persists, the limit switch settings may need adjustment — our technicians can fix this in 15–30 minutes.
Most garage door openers last 10–15 years with regular maintenance. Signs it's time to replace in Saginaw: frequent breakdowns, grinding or rattling noise, slow or inconsistent operation, or lack of modern safety features like battery backup and smartphone control.
